A female domestic fowl, especially one kept for laying eggs. Hens are typically smaller than roosters and have a variety of breeds, each with unique characteristics like plumage color, size, and egg-laying frequency. They play a crucial role in agriculture and food production. Beyond farming, hens are also kept as pets, often providing fresh eggs and companionship. The term is frequently used metaphorically to describe a woman or, less commonly, a coward.
